Roanoke advertises at the top of this page. I live 6 blocks from Green Dodge. They had a Silver Momba Viper and would not let me touch it let alone sit in it. I told them I wanted a red one and they did not take me serious and even offer to find me one. I contacted Roanoke early last April via e-mail at their web site and they had exactly what I was looking for. I could not believe how well I was treated and the deal I got on my 03 SRT10 Vert. We just traded our 2004 Pacifica for a new Hemi Charger R/T last Friday and drove 100 miles [not 6 blocks] to Roanoke because they want, appreciate [and tell us] and earn our business. They did not have the color we wanted in stock but within 2 days they did. We've dealt with John and Dennis both. They are very professional, courteous and know their products and throughly explain their cars features to you. They offer the best deals I've ever gotten too. My wife manages a local office furniture business and deals with sales people every day and was very impressed with them and that says a lot for them. Plus they have the best Mopar toy store I've ever seen with over 30 Vipers in stock. They had 4 new Copperheads, 2 Coupes and 2 Verts. Pics do not do them justice you have to see them. I going to have to trade for one in another year or two. They also had an original 1968 Black Hemi Roadrunner on the show room floor that I drooled all over too.
Give these guys a try, you won't regret it and tell'em we sent ya.
